SALT LAKE CITY — A custody fight in Virginia led to a judge’s order that a 4-year-old boy spend the summer in Utah with his mother, who will be charged as an accomplice to the youngster’s killing, police and a family member said yesterday.
“I can’t talk right now. I just got the horrible news, talking to prosecutors,’’ said Joe G. Stacy of Tazewell, Va., who is the biological father of Ethan Stacy.
The boy’s body was desecrated and buried in a northern Utah canyon, where it was recovered Tuesday, police said.
The stepfather, Nathanael W. Sloop, 31, of Layton, is being held on suspicion of aggravated murder. He and the boy’s mother, Stephanie Sloop, 27, also face additional charges of desecration of a corpse, felony child abuse, and obstruction of justice.![]()
